puddin 7 Posted December 5, 2009 I think I have swelling around the band. I had a baby almost 6 weeks ago, and i think that has made me swollen. I was filled to only a 1.5 (I was totally unfilled during my pregnancy) and I still get stuck quite a bit. I've done mushies and liquids for 24 hours but the inflammation is still there when I go for solids again. Any advice on how to decrease the inflammation? soocalchic 1,087 Posted December 9, 2009 you just had a baby, post partum your body is getting rid of excess fluids. Seems almost natural that you would have some inflamation. You might want to stay on liquids for a couple of days like the other folks recomend make sure you keep hydrated stay away from salts. It might help to walk around a littlebit also. Can i ask a question and i hope I'm not intruding? was this a natural birth? The only reason I ask is that all the bearing down might had slipped your band. You might want to get in and see your surgeon if your symptoms dont improve.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
